  By: Eiland H.R. No. 1376
 
 
 
R E S O L U T I O N
         WHEREAS, Sharon Strain, the executive director of the
  Galveston Housing Authority, is ending one chapter of her life and
  beginning another with her retirement at the end of May 2007; and
         WHEREAS, The Galveston Housing Authority oversees nearly
  1,000 units of federally subsidized housing, a rental assistance
  program, and several programs promoting home ownership; and
         WHEREAS, In her 10 years directing the housing authority, Ms.
  Strain has been instrumental in revitalizing the public housing
  system in Galveston; taking charge of the organization during a
  challenging time in its history, she successfully worked to restore
  the authority's "high performer" rating with the U.S. Department of
  Housing and Urban Development; and
         WHEREAS, Ms. Strain's superb management skills have been
  matched by her genuine compassion for the residents of public
  housing; not only has she worked to ensure housing for Galveston's
  neediest and most vulnerable citizens, she has also been a leader in
  the effort to help low-income and middle-income residents buy their
  own homes; and
         WHEREAS, Sharon Strain may indeed reflect with pride on her
  innovative leadership, which has helped to ensure a brighter future
  for countless area Texans; now, therefore, be it
         RESOLVED, That the House of Representatives of the 80th Texas
  Legislature hereby commend Sharon Strain on her outstanding tenure
  with the Galveston Housing Authority and extend best wishes to her
  for a happy retirement; and, be it further
         RESOLVED, That an official copy of this resolution be
  prepared for Ms. Strain as an expression of high regard by the Texas
  House of Representatives.
